What is Data Transfer Success Rate?

The percentage of data transfers that are completed without error.

What is the standard formula?

(Number of Successful Data Transfers / Total Data Transfers) * 100

Data Transfer Success Rate Interpretation

High values of Data Transfer Success Rate suggest that data is being transmitted reliably and efficiently, contributing to seamless operations. Conversely, low values may indicate systemic issues, such as network bottlenecks or inadequate infrastructure. Ideal targets typically hover above 95%, ensuring minimal disruptions in data flow.

  • 90%–95% – Acceptable; monitor for potential issues
  • 80%–89% – Concerning; investigate root causes
  • <80% – Critical; immediate action required

Common Pitfalls

Data Transfer Success Rate can often mislead executives if not interpreted correctly.

  • Overlooking network capacity can lead to underperformance. Insufficient bandwidth may cause data loss or delays, distorting the success rate and impacting operational efficiency.
  • Neglecting to update software and hardware can create vulnerabilities. Outdated systems often struggle with data integrity, leading to increased failure rates during transfers.
  • Failing to establish clear data governance policies can result in inconsistent data handling. Without defined protocols, discrepancies in data formats may arise, complicating transfers and reducing success rates.
  • Ignoring user training can hinder effective data management. Employees unfamiliar with data transfer tools may inadvertently cause errors, negatively affecting the success rate.

Improvement Levers

Enhancing Data Transfer Success Rate requires a proactive approach to identify and eliminate barriers to efficient data flow.

  • Invest in robust infrastructure to support data transfer needs. Upgrading network capabilities can significantly reduce latency and improve overall success rates.
  • Implement automated monitoring tools to track data transfer performance. Real-time analytics can provide insights into failure points, enabling timely interventions.
  • Standardize data formats across systems to minimize discrepancies. Consistency in data handling improves transfer reliability and reduces errors.
  • Provide comprehensive training for staff on data transfer protocols. Empowering employees with knowledge enhances their ability to manage data effectively, boosting success rates.

Data Transfer Success Rate Case Study Example

A leading telecommunications provider faced challenges with its Data Transfer Success Rate, which had plummeted to 75%. This decline was affecting customer satisfaction and compliance with service level agreements. To address this, the company initiated a project called "Data Flow Optimization," focusing on upgrading its network infrastructure and implementing advanced monitoring tools.

The project involved a thorough analysis of existing data transfer processes, identifying bottlenecks and areas for improvement. By investing in high-capacity routers and enhancing their data management software, the company aimed to streamline operations. Additionally, they established a dedicated team to oversee data governance and ensure compliance with industry standards.

Within 6 months, the Data Transfer Success Rate improved to 92%, significantly enhancing customer experience and reducing operational costs. The company also reported a 15% increase in customer retention rates, attributing this success to the improved reliability of their services. The initiative not only strengthened their market position but also fostered a culture of continuous improvement and data-driven decision-making.

FAQs

What factors influence Data Transfer Success Rate?

Several factors can impact this KPI, including network capacity, data governance policies, and employee training. Ensuring robust infrastructure and clear protocols can enhance transfer reliability.

How often should this KPI be monitored?

Regular monitoring is essential, ideally on a daily or weekly basis. Frequent assessments allow organizations to quickly identify and address any emerging issues.

What is an acceptable success rate for data transfers?

An ideal success rate typically exceeds 95%. Rates below this threshold may indicate underlying issues that require immediate attention.

Can improving this KPI impact overall business performance?

Yes, a higher Data Transfer Success Rate can lead to improved operational efficiency and customer satisfaction. This, in turn, positively affects financial health and strategic alignment.

What tools can help track this KPI?

Various business intelligence tools and analytics platforms can effectively track data transfer performance. Implementing automated monitoring solutions can provide real-time insights and alerts.

How does this KPI relate to other performance indicators?

Data Transfer Success Rate is closely linked to operational efficiency and customer satisfaction metrics. Improvements in this area often lead to better financial ratios and overall business outcomes.
